Cate Blanchett Is Radiant at 'A Star Is Born' Venice Film Festival Premiere!

Cate Blanchett is picture perfect as she hits the red carpet ahead of the premiere screening of A Star Is Born held during the 2018 Venice Film Festival at Sala Grande on Friday (August 31) in Venice, Italy.

The 49-year-old Oscar-winning actress stepped out to show her support for the film alongside Spike Lee and his wife Tonya Lewis Lee, Lorenzo Richelmy and Venice Virtual Reality jury member Clémence Poésy.

PHOTOS: Check out the latest pics of Cate Blanchett

The stars of the film, Lady Gaga and Bradley Coper, were the first to hit the red carpet hand-in-hand.

FYI: Cate is wearing Armani Privé with Chopard jewelry. Clémence is wearing Fendi.

'Marco Polo's Lorenzo Richelmy: 5 Things to Know About Netflix's New Star

The highly anticipated original series Marco Polo premieres on Netflix today and we are currently crushing on the really hot star, Lorenzo Richelmy.

The 24-year-old actor has been acting for years in his home country of Italy, but this is his first major role in an American production.

He didn’t speak English when he was offered the role: “I was terrified,” Lorenzo told Reuters. “Language is one of the most important things for an actor, so I worked a lot to learn.”

He is in a relationship: “My girlfriend and I Skyped every day while I was filming around the world,” Lorenzo told Glamour. “It was beautiful to understand that two people can be together without living together every day. It’s much better than a relationship where one person lives for the other.”

He didn’t know what Netflix was: “The first time they told me it was Netflix, I said ‘I wish it was HBO,’ Lorenzo said. “And then I realized it’s much better.”

He got his start on the stage: “I was four,” Lorenzo told People magazine. “I was the son of the main actress, who was actually my real mother, and I just had to get onstage and say, ‘Here’s the chicken!’

He’s going nude for the show: “Totally nudity, yes, but not frontal,” Lorenzo told ET Online.
